Bulgaria's Cocaine-Traffickers Most Prominent in SEE Region

Bulgarian criminal gangs are among the major cocaine traffickers in South-Eastern Europe and the Black Sea region, a Darik News investigation has revealed.

Over the past months local drug dealers have abandoned the heroin trade, because of the drug's high price and the low demand and they switched to cocaine Nikolay Hristov reported. A total of five major organizations in the Balkan country have their hands on the cocaine market, the investigation has showed.

Interior Ministry insiders claim that most of the drug trafficking goes through Varna port at the seaside, where a gangster by the allias of Ivo Gela (the gel) controls all packages. The man used to be close with businessman Georgi Iliev, who was shot dead last summer.

Ivo Gela had woven a tangled web of underlings throughout the seaside city, and the whole network is headed by a man called Valyo Bandita (the bandit).

Sourthern seaside traffickers answer to people from the circles of Dimitar Zhelyazkov dubbed Ochite, one of Bulgaria's most notorious underworld suspects, while Sofia is the turf of people close to defunct strong-arm organization VIS.

Konstantin Dishliev, who was murdered in one of many ganglike hits in 2005, also used to be one of the key figures in the cocaine trade in Sofia.

Two Bulgarian gangs from Spain that have a past in car-stealing also often land a helping hand in the cocaine traffic, people at the Interior Ministry believe. These are the link between Latin America and Europe and often aid drug trafficking from Venezuela or Colombia through Bulgaria to the Netherlands and Spain.

Bulgarian traffickers rarely risk transporting drugs by car, and their preferred transportation means are yachts and ships.
